1. Definitions

"Account Information" means information provided by you to create, support and maintain an account enabling access to the Service

"Nicest.ai Platform" means the software or other technology provided by us to you under these Terms. The Nicest.ai Platform does not include Third-Party Products

"Beta Services" means products, services, integrations, functionality or features that Nicest.ai may make available to you to try at your discretion, which may be described as "alpha," "beta," "pilot," "limited release," "developer preview," "non-production," "early-stage", or other similar description

"Contributor Database" means the database of Personal Information and other business information which we make available, directly or indirectly, to you and to other Nicest.ai customers through the Nicest.ai Platform

"Output Data" means the information and other content or materials that are included in the Contributor Database or otherwise made available to you through the Nicest.ai Platform. Output Data is exclusive of the Submitted Data

"Order Form" means an ordering document, including an order receipt, related to your ordering of the Service and specifying the details of your subscription and any fees to be paid by you

"Personal Information" includes any substantially similar terms to "personal information" such as "personal data" or "personally identifiable information" and as to each, shall have the meaning given to such terms under applicable law

"Service" means the Output Data, the Service Metadata, the Contributor Database, the Nicest.ai Platform, the Beta Services and any accompanying or related infrastructure, functionality, technology or analytics, including any services or add-ons described in an Order Form

"Service Metadata" means information collected or inferred by us in the course of delivering emails (including without limitation information about deliverability and system operations) or otherwise providing the Service

"Submitted Data" means all data, information, text, recordings, and other content and materials that are collected, submitted, provided, or otherwise transmitted or stored by you in connection with your use of the Service

"Third-Party Products" means products, services, websites, applications or other technology, and any related content, that you choose to integrate with or use in connection with the Service. Third-Party Products are not owned or operated by us

"UK/EU GDPR" means the General Data Protection Regulation (Regulation (EU) 2016/679) and equivalent requirements in the United Kingdom including the Data Protection Act 2018 and the United Kingdom General Data Protection Regulation

"Website" means any website or webpage on which these Terms appear

2. Your Account; Eligibility Restrictions; Beta Services; Third-Party Products

Account information

You will need to set up an account in order to access the Service, including to receive Output Data. You must only provide Account Information that is your own and that is accurate. You must also keep your contact information up to date, so that we may contact you if needed, such as to deliver any important notices.

Eligibility restrictions

You shall ensure that only your employees or service providers, or the employees or service providers of your wholly or majority owned subsidiaries who have been expressly authorized by you to use the Service in accordance with this Terms of Service, shall use or otherwise access the Service ("Authorized Users"). You may not use the Service if you or any of your Authorized Users are a competitor of Nicest.ai (as determined by us in our sole discretion). You shall ensure that all Authorized Users are at or above the age of majority in their jurisdiction. You must comply with any other eligibility restrictions on Authorized Users set forth in the Order Form and ensure that your Authorized Users comply with these Terms.

Account security

We make no representations or promises regarding the security of the Service. Despite our security efforts, it is possible that unauthorized individuals will obtain your information, such as through web-scraping tools (even though we do not authorize and in fact prohibit that behavior). You agree and understand that you will be liable for any activity that occurs through your account and further acknowledge and agree that you and your Authorized Users:

  • are solely responsible for maintaining the confidentiality and security of your Account Information and account credentials such as your username and password.
  • may not share your account credentials and must restrict access to your computer and other devices.
  • must access the Service and our network, systems, or applications only through encrypted connections.
  • must maintain up-to-date OS (operating system) patching and active anti-malware on the end-user devices used to connect to the Service or our environment.
  • must ensure that all terminated employees or other users have their access revoked to the Service within 24 hours of termination.
  • must notify us promptly (and in any event within 72 hours) of security incidents that could have implications to us (e.g. users with compromised credentials or lost or stolen devices with access to the Service, compromised networks or systems including malware worm or ransomware, etc.).
  • will reach out to our vulnerability discovery program at support@nicest.ai if you suspect any vulnerabilities with our Service.
